The 4032 postcode area, including Chermside Bc, Craigslea, Chermside, Chermside Centre, Chermside South and Chermside West, is home to 6758 vehicles. Among these, 382 are electric cars, which include battery electric vehicles (BEVs), pl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s), hybrid vehicles, and fuel cell electric vehicles (FCEVs). This means that6% of the region’s vehicles are now electric, highlighting a growing shift towards sustainable transportation.

Assuming each vehile travels an average of 10,000km per year, the ICE (Internal Combustion Engine) vehicles in Chermside Bc, Craigslea, Chermside, Chermside Centre, Chermside South and Chermside West are emitting approximately 13967 tonnes of CO2 per year.

Collectively, electric vehicles (EVs) can be charged using solar energy. Based on sunshine data from the nearest weather station, Chermside Bowls Club, a typical household with a 6 kW solar power system can charge an EV to travel up to 200 km per day during the summer month of January, and 112 km per day in July, with an annual average of 159 km per day.

To facilitate this transition to electric cars and hybrid vehicles, there are around 44 public EV charging stations within 20 km of Chermside Bc, making it easier for residents and visitors to charge their vehicles and drive sustainably.

With a population of 17026 people, Chermside Bc has 6758 motor vehicles based on the Australian Bureau Of Statistics 2021 Census. This is made up of 3689 homes with 1 motor vehicle, 2303 homes with 2 motor vehicles, and 766 of homes with 3 motor vehicles or more.

With 44 public ev charging stations in Chermside Bc and a combined 382 registered vehicles that are either battery electric vehicles (BEVs), pl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s), hybrid vehicles, there’s a growing interest in electric cars and Chermside Bc electric car charging stations. For the 1886 homes that already have solar panels in the 4032 postcode, being 22% of the total 8405 homes in this community, Chermside Bc EV owners who combine home solar panels with an EV charger with benefit financially whilst also reducing their environmental impact.

Chermside Bc’s streets are buzzing with a quiet revolution – electric vehicles (EVs) are becoming a common sight in this sunny Queensland suburb. With an eco-conscious community and an average solar radiation of 5.2 kW/m²/day (converted from 18.70 MJ/m²/day), it’s no wonder EV registrations here have nearly doubled since 2021. Back then, just 194 electric vehicles called Chermside home, but by 2023, that number surged to 382 – a 97% increase. Public Charging Made Easy Within a 20km radius of Chermside Bc, you’ll find 44 public electric vehicle charging stations designed for convenience. Westfield Chermside Shopping Centre leads the pack with fast-charging CCS2 ports, letting you top up while grabbing groceries. The Prince Charles Hospital offers reliable Type 2 chargers – perfect for visitors supporting patients or healthcare workers. For community-focused charging, the Kedron-Wavell Services Club provides dual CCS2/Type 2 stations alongside its popular bistro.

Compatibility Matters Local charging networks like Chargefox and Evie Networks dominate the landscape, compatible with popular models such as the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ross PHEV and BMW 5 Series PHEV. CCS2 connectors (used by 80% of new EVs in Australia) dominate public stations, while Type 2 ports cater to older models. Though CHAdeMO stations are rare, most Nissan Leaf owners can still find compatible options through the Chargefox network.

Solar: The Smart Charger’s Choice Chermside’s abundant sunshine transforms rooftops into personal power stations. A typical 6kW solar system here generates about 31kWh daily – enough to fully charge a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ross PHEV’s 16.8kWh battery while still powering household appliances. Over a year, this could save $650+ in fuel costs compared to petrol vehicles. Many locals time their charging for daylight hours, using smart chargers to maximise solar self-consumption.

Future-Proof Your Drive As Chermside’s EV community grows, pairing home charging with solar makes increasing sense. Modern wallboxes like the Zappi charger can prioritise solar energy, automatically switching to grid power only when needed. With battery-electric vehicles like the MINI Countryman PHEV (15.2kWh/100km) requiring just 4 hours of sunshine for a 50km range, solar charging turns Queensland’s climate into a financial advantage.
